2 IEEE PELS and IEEE PES Launch a New Industry- Focused Workshop on Electronic Power Transmission and Distribution It is our pleasure to invite you to the IEEE Workshop on Electronic Power Transmission and Distribution (et&d) on 7-9 November, 2017, in Aalborg, Denmark. Power electronics is changing from a technology that enables renewable generation and energy-efficiency improvement to the foundational technology for grid modernization. Electronic power transmission and distribution power grids are being envisioned in the near future. The workshop, jointly sponsored by the IEEE Power Electronics Society (PELS) and the IEEE Power & Energy Society (PES), is organized by Aalborg University, Denmark. This year s event will be focused on industry, consisting of 3 Executive sessions, 5 Industry Panel sessions, and 2 Technical E- poster sessions, with over 80 presentations from government, industry, and academia. A tutorial on IEEE Std for interconnecting distributed energy resources with electric power systems, and a technical tour on 1.7 GW (LCC- and MMC-) HVDC station will be provided. All presentations will be archived in the IEEE PELS and PES Resource Centers. If you have any needs during the conference we will do our best to help you. We look forward to seeing you in Aalborg.
